Save big with these discounts

Insurance can be prohibitively expensive, but companies offer discounts to cut the cost considerably. A few discounts will automatically apply when you complete an application, but less common discounts must be inquired about before they will apply.

  • Fewer Miles Equal More Savings - Fewer annual miles can earn lower rates on the low mileage vehicles.
  • Multiple Vehicles - Insuring multiple vehicles on the same auto insurance policy qualifies for this discount.
  • Student in College - Children who attend school more than 100 miles from home and do not have access to a covered vehicle may qualify for this discount.
  • Senior Discount - Mature drivers may be able to get a discount up to 10%.
  • Drivers Education - Have your child enroll in driver's education if it's offered in school.
  • Use Seat Belts - Using a seat belt and requiring all passengers to buckle their seat belts can save 10% or more off the personal injury premium cost.
  • Federal Government Employee - Being employed by or retired from a federal job may qualify you for a discount depending on your company.
  • No Claims - Drivers with accident-free driving histories can save substantially when compared with bad drivers.

Consumers should know that most credits do not apply to all coverage premiums. Most cut the price of certain insurance coverages like liability and collision coverage. So despite the fact that it appears having all the discounts means you get insurance for free, companies don't profit that way. Any qualifying discounts will bring down your overall premium however.
